CDV Delete - Anyone order from Zeckhausen Racing?
I know this topic has been discussed at length but at 1200 miles, I'm still hating the effects of the CDV. I've gotten use to the CDV and I'm getting a smooth shift from 1st-2nd about 90% of the time. The 90% is done with much thought which takes the pleasure out of driving intuitively. Unlike my VW Golf, I get in and don't even have to think about shifting, it's smooth & easy. I'm in a love/hate thing with my E90 at this point.
I sent an email to Zeckenhauesen weeks back and they have not replied to my questions. Once a CDV delete is done can it be changed back to the OEM? In case I don't like the effects of the CDV delete either. Anyone that has done the CDV delete, please share your experience. Thanks!

Well after talking to Dave Zeckhausen yesterday, I decided to get the modified CDV from him instead of doing the CDV delete. I bought it for $37.50 shipped. It should be here next week. Dave said the benefits of the modified CDV is that your car will look stock. Where as if the CDV was deleted it may be noticed by the BMW machanic and may cause some warranty issues. Now I just have to find a shop that knows how to do this and for a reasonable price. So far, I got a quote from BPM in Mass. for $190, for 2 hours of labor. From doing a bit of research and asking folks on other boards, it's a simple procedure that should take 30 minutes - 1hour tops. I'll keep the board posted on how it goes.
